ddns-scripts: add support for Porkbun
Extends DDNS support for the Porkbun v3 JSON API with a custom update script and service configuration. See: https://porkbun.com/api/json/v3/documentation Depends on cURL (with SSL) for transport. Porkbun authentication API keys and secret keys are passed through the ddns-scripts "username" and "password" variables, respectively. As Porkbun DNS is currently backed by Cloudflare, also support ddns-scripts "rec_id" variable for specific record targeting. Signed-off-by: Ansel Horn <dev@cahorn.net>
